At the Edge of Love is a quiet, deeply moving novel about starting over, healing from loss, and discovering love in unexpected places.

When Elif leaves behind her broken life on the mainland, she arrives at the remote island of Ayanē with nothing but her grief and uncertainty. She seeks no grand romance, no dramatic rescue—only the space to breathe, to plant, to begin again. Surrounded by the island's windswept coasts, spiral stone paths, and a community bound by tradition, Elif slowly learns to listen—to the land, to herself, and to the gentle rhythms of a life rebuilt from scratch.

Here, she meets Yusuf, a man carrying storms of his own. Together, they cultivate a love that is patient, grounded, and quietly powerful. Through seasons of planting and harvest, silence and conversation, they discover that love is not always about sweeping gestures—it's about trust, growth, and the courage to stay.

A lyrical blend of literary fiction and wholesome romance, At the Edge of Love will resonate with readers who cherish stories of self-discovery, rural and coastal life, and the beauty found in second chances. Perfect for fans of slow-burn love stories, emotional women's fiction, and atmospheric settings that feel as alive as the characters themselves.
